Infrastructure giant Larsen & Toubro (L&T) on Thursday said it has sold its entire 89% stake in L&T Infocity Ltd (LTIL) to Hyderabad-based Ace Urban Developers Ltd for Rs 191 crore.

L&T Infocity Ltd is an special purpose vehicle (SPV) formed by the infrastructure major in partnership with Andhra Pradesh Infrastructure Investment Corporation (APIIC) to develop IT infrastructure in the state.

"L&T promoted, an SPV formed in 1997 in partnership with APIIC to develop IT infrastructure in Andhra Pradesh. L&T owns 89 per cent stake in the SPV and the balance is held by APIIC...L&T has exited by divesting its 89% holding in LTIL to Hyderabad based infrastructure development company," it said in a BSE filing.

The SPV had a revenue of Rs 36 crore in 2015-16 with a profit after tax of Rs 7 crore.

The agreement for sale had been entered on February 18, 2016.

L&T said the consideration received from "such sale/disposal (is) Rs 191 crore".

The company said that apart from the IT infrastructure developments in Hyderabad, LTIL has also partnered in three ventures with equity investments.

It said that LTIL holds 58.11% in HITEX Ltd, an exhibition infrastructure venture, and 74% in L&T HiTech City Ltd, an IT special economic zone at Vijaywada. 

Additionally, LTIL owns 26% in Visakhapatnam IT Park Ltd, an IT Park at Visakhapatnam.
